Dimensions

Brick flat dimensions:
Length: 7.5"
Height: 2.5"
Thickness: .75"

Corner dimensions:
Short side: 2.5"
Long side: 7.5"
Height: 2.5"

Materials

Mountain View Stone brick veneer is produced by combining Portland cement, lightweight aggregate, and iron oxide mineral colors.

Installation Instructions

Brick veneer is an individual brick product and is installed piece by piece. The individual bricks will vary in size, shape, and thickness. In order to achieve the desired real brick finish as shown in our images it is up to the installer to arrange the individual bricks in the correct pattern and install each brick one at a time.   • So I am planning to put this on drywall and was wondering if it can take the weight of the stones or if I would need to do something else. Do you just use adhesive and then grout in between the bricks?

    Thank you for your question and interest in our brick veneer. Our installation instructions can be downloaded at https://mountainviewstone.net/pages/post-purchase-support. For the surface prep, which is the most important step, you will need to install a moisture barrier and then install wire lath over that. Make sure the nails or screws for wire lath hit studs to ensure a good foundation. Your scratch coat goes over the wire lath and then the stone veneer. We recommend our stone veneer and brick veneer be installed with Type S mortar. Mortar is recommended for installation opposed to an adhesive as mortar is cheaper than adhesive, and when installing with an adhesive you must hold the stone in place until the adhesive sets which really slows down installation time, whereas mortar instantly holds.
